Whether you're new to the brew or an espresso expert, whether you prefer it with or without caffeine , there's always more to learn about ...This is Vietnam’s standard coffee drink. It combines rich Robusta coffee with sweetened condensed milk. The milk to coffee ratio is usually 50/50. This drink is usually served cold with ice but you can order it hot as well. Coffee consumption is used for social activity, leisure, improvement of work performance, and well-being.The word "lungo" literally means "long", and the "lungo" gets its name from the way it's made. It is made with a so-called "long pull" (slower and more voluminous extraction) of espresso. It's prepared with the same amount of finely ground coffee and twice the water of a normal espresso shot. A piccolo coffee is a single ristretto shot pulled into a 90ml glass and then topped up with steamed milk. The result is a small, strong drink with more coffee than milk. Or maybe you’re already an oat milk aficionado, and just want some more info about your fave non-dairy d...Summary of the findings. In this meta-analysis, higher coffee consumption was significantly associated with a reduced risk of prostate cancer in men. In the dose–response analysis, a reduction in the risk of prostate cancer of nearly 1% was observed for each increment of one cup of coffee per day. The Eye’s Have it! Lazy Eye – A cup of Decaf American Coffee with decaf espresso. Red Eye – A cup of American drip coffee with a shot of espresso. Black Eye – A cup of American drip coffee with 2 shots of espresso. Dead Eye – A cup of American drip coffee with 3 shots of espresso.
